Transaction cd77381e9fab430d23f0830c1c18e502e0d3a0697fee779a40693e6c9bce5ec2
1 Input
1 Output
-
cd77381e9fab430d23f0830c1c18e502e0d3a0697fee779a40693e6c9bce5ec2:0
- value
- 561675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7729ce76afbb97e40c41ca24789c6819455f037 OP_EQUAL
- address
- 3MLCWEPRxmj5Q1k8tSLFMNHK4Ny8jsYVLQ